Lahore: The National Grid Company of Pakistan (NGC) bid farewell to Engr. Dr. Rana Abdul Jabbar Khan, former Managing Director of NGC and outgoing General Manager (HVDC), following his appointment as Chief Executive Officer of Quaid-e-Azam Thermal Power (Pvt.) Limited (QATPL).
In a farewell meeting, Managing Director Engr. Shahid Nazir and Deputy Managing Director (AD&M) Engr. Rasheed A. Bhutto acknowledged Dr Rana’s contributions across HVDC and other technical domains, noting his role in strengthening operational practices and project execution. They extended best wishes for his continued success in the power sector.
Chief Engineer (HVDC) Engr. Shakeel Ahmed Awan, along with officers and staff, shared their appreciation for Dr Rana’s leadership and collaborative approach. A farewell ceremony was held at his office, where a souvenir was presented as a token of regard.
Dr. Rana also visited the Technical Services Group (TSG) at New Kot Lakhpat, Lahore, where he revisited the mosque constructed during his tenure. He was warmly received by Chief Engineer TSG Engr. Muhammad Arif and team members, who acknowledged his efforts in introducing innovative approaches to technical training and capacity building within the group.
With over 33 years of service in NGC and other power sector organizations, Dr. Rana Abdul Jabbar Khan embarks on a new chapter in his professional journey, bringing forward a wealth of experience and institutional insight.
